摘要
近期在广东市场出现了一种蓝色的、外观似针钠钙石的玉石,为查明其矿物组成及颜色成因,采用常规的宝石学测试,结合激光拉曼光谱仪、红外吸收光谱仪、紫外-可见分光光度计、X射线荧光光谱仪等大型仪器,对该玉石样品的宝石学特征做了一系列的研究。研究结果表明:样品的折射率为1.52~1.66(点测),相对密度约为2.69;拉曼光谱显示样品主要成分为文石;红外光谱的分析结果进一步验证了该样品为无机成因的文石;紫外-可见分光光度计和X射线荧光光谱仪的分析结果推断,该样品的蓝色是由Cu^(2+)以类质同象的方式替换了Ca^(2+)所致。
Currently, a kind of blue jade appears in Guangdong market, which likes pectolite. The gemmological characteristics of this jade are researched by using conventional gemmo-logical testing methods and Raman spectroscopy, FTIR, UV-Vis absorption spectrometer, X-ray fluorescence spectrometer. The results showed that the RI of the sample is 1. 52 - 1. 66 (point measurement), and relative density is 2. 69. Raman spectrum showed that the main mineral component of the sample is aragonite, and FTIR analysis results further valida-ted that the sample is inorganic aragonite. The results of UV-Vis absorption spectrometer and X-ray fluorescence spectrometer showed that the colour of the aragonite sample is caused by Cu2+ , which replaces Ca2+ in mineral.
